A pleasant experience
What do you like best about the product?
I like the clean UI design of the product. And it's nice to have a location where we can keep all of the task tracking, support pages, and internal product docs together.
What do you dislike about the product?
It's really easy to create sub pages and templates that contain sub pages. Because of the ease of nesting it makes it difficult to find pages that were generated through templates or just find sub pages or sub databases.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
The inline ai writing assistant is amazing. It does a great job and creating a first draft for support pages, offer letters, and other official communication that requires a particular format and tone. We've taken a full transcript from our demo videos and given it to the writing assistant to the formulate into a support page. It's a super useful feature

Very Customizable Database and Workflow Tool
What do you like best about the product?
Notion is extremely flexible and open with its application. It borders on a no-code app building solution because you can do so much. I love the way it's structured to make references to other databases and build pages within pages within pages.
What do you dislike about the product?
Tables are powerful, but so much less intuitive than Excel or Sheets. The interface for working within tables is kind of clunky and difficult to do repeat processes.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
Notion helps our teams to keep everything in the same place for internal operations. The AI writing assistant gives me a quick way to generate content for advertisements, websites, social media...etc.

I've gone all-in with Notion and it's for the better.
What do you like best about the product?
Love using it as a tool to organize my knowledge (and most importantly, activate my knowledge). It helps me with tracking my reading, and connecting back to tasks at hand.
What do you dislike about the product?
It took a learning curve for sure. I'm still mastering new features, including the nuances of the AI tool. Being a Confluence user in my day-job, I find that I would love more fluidity between the two platforms, despite being competitors. I have expectations around shortcuts that don't necessarily translate to what's in other platforms. For example, using CMD-P as a search shortcut is a weird nuance to Notion that doesn't exist anywhere else.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
Single-source of truth for knowledge, whether for an individual user or a team user.
